Safety and Compliance

When using Gripit power tool accessories, following HSE guidelines for power tool operation is essential. Always wear appropriate personal protective equipment including safety glasses to protect against plasterboard dust and debris, and ensure adequate dust extraction or ventilation when drilling, particularly during extended installation sessions. Inspect drill bits before use to ensure they're free from damage that could affect performance or cause breakage during operation.

Select the appropriate drill speed for the material being worked – plasterboard and hollow walls require moderate speeds to prevent overheating and material damage. Excessive speed can cause the drill bit to grab or the plasterboard to tear, compromising the installation quality. Apply steady, controlled pressure rather than forcing the drill, allowing the cutting edges to work efficiently without placing undue stress on the accessory or power tool.

Ensure power tools used with Gripit accessories are properly maintained and, where applicable, PAT tested in accordance with workplace regulations. When working on site, be aware of hidden services within walls before drilling, using appropriate detection equipment to locate cables and pipes. Store Gripit accessories in their original packaging or suitable containers to protect cutting edges from damage and contamination that could affect performance.

Are Gripit drill bits suitable for use with standard power drills?

Yes, Gripit drill bits are designed to work with both cordless and 240v corded power drills fitted with standard keyless or keyed chucks. They feature industry-standard shank sizes that ensure secure fitting and reliable performance across different drill brands and models. For best results, use at moderate drilling speeds appropriate for plasterboard work.

Can I use regular drill bits instead of Gripit accessories with Gripit fixings?

While standard drill bits can create holes in plasterboard, Gripit accessories are specifically engineered to produce the clean, precisely-sized holes that allow Gripit fixings to achieve their maximum load capacity and reliability. Generic drill bits may create ragged edges, oversized holes, or cause plasterboard crumbling that compromises fixing performance. Using matched Gripit accessories ensures optimal results and reduces installation failures.
